diff --git a/nix/modules/home-manager/cli/neovim.nix b/nix/modules/home-manager/cli/neovim.nix index b19bc390..c6e5c6ea 100644 --- a/nix/modules/home-manager/cli/neovim.nix +++ b/nix/modules/home-manager/cli/neovim.nix @@ -140,6 +140,7 @@ in # Language servers bash-language-server dockerfile-language-server-nodejs + emmet-language-server gopls lua-language-server lua54Packages.luacheck diff --git a/nvim/lua/opdavies/lsp/init.lua b/nvim/lua/opdavies/lsp/init.lua index 1f34c9f7..5195893c 100644 --- a/nvim/lua/opdavies/lsp/init.lua +++ b/nvim/lua/opdavies/lsp/init.lua @@ -15,6 +15,11 @@ lspconfig.cssls.setup { end, } +lspconfig.emmet_language_server.setup { + capabilities = capabilities, + filetypes = { "css", "html", "sass", "scss", "twig" }, +} + lspconfig.gopls.setup { capabilities = capabilities, }